    Hello,

    recently some customers get the following error message when they want to pay with PayPal:
    “MISSING_SHIPPING_ADDRESS The shipping address is required when shipping_preference=SET_PROVIDED_ADDRESS.”

    How can I fix this error? If I check and uncheck the “Ship to another address?” it works. It is also strange that the error does not always appear.

    We have seen some instances of this issue before, but it seems to not occur with many merchants. There are 2 things we would advise you to try in order to correct this behavior:

    1. Try changing the field “Default customer location” to “shop country/region” in the page WooCommerce > Settings > General, and see if that improves the situation.
    2. You may want to perform a full conflict test to rule out eventual issues with the theme or a different plugin. We recommend temporarily activating the default theme Storefront and disabling all other plugins except for WooCommerce and PayPal Payments to see if the behavior persists. Here’s a guide that explains the steps in more detail: How to test for conflicts.

    here’s how I solved the problem. Deleted the content on the checkout page and added the default WooCommerce shortcode [woocommerce_checkout]. IMPORTANT: Make a backup of the page before and test it on a staging or test page first.

    I use the Divi theme and there are several shortcodes stored on the checkout page that can be used to customize the page. Unfortunately there seems to be a problem Divi shortcodes. With the standard WooCommerce shortcode the page is not as customizable as the Divi page but at least everything works with it.
